    A good point you made in another video applies here too - ensure that the market supply storage only keeps the stuff that is sold on the market. To avoid your warehouse workers going everywhere and hauling all other stuff - which in turn hurts the market supply. Components, construction stuff etc should have its own storehouse! Similar with granaries - making sure that market granary only has final products, instead of workers running aaaaall the way to the farms to pick up wheat for god knows what reason.

    I find demolishing empty marketplace stalls dramatically helps. The problem I noticed is that I'd have a vast surplus of materials, like say firewood, but not all plots would be supplied. This is because I frequently toggle families onto and off of gathering buildings as those materials are needed. Each time they're added to a building a new stall will be set up and linked to the gathering building. Then when the family is rotated off the building, the stall will remain linked to the gathering building which has no inventory to pull from. My marketplace would fill up with empty stalls over time. There's an 'abandoned stall' mechanism in the game but it doesn't correct for this issue. After going through and demolishing all stalls with empty or single material of supplies, my logistics workers were able to establish stalls linked to the stockhouse/granary inventories and keep inventories maintained. It also helped with overall town efficiency because unassigned families weren't wasting time often walking back to the marketplace to construct useless stalls while building projects would idle.

    Great question - If my explanation doesn't make sense here, I did cover it a video I did a few days ago: kzread.info/dash/bejne/ZZOtyaijmpiwgqg.html&ab_channel=StratGamingGuides There are 2 ways to do this: You can remove the workers from the production building that is running the stall. Once you take everyone out of that building, the stall will become "abandoned". Next, go to your storehouse or granary and put a new worker on. The new worker you place will immediately take over the stall and you can put the rest back on the production building. The other method is to find out who's running the stall, click the people tab and see which building they are working at. On the right side, there's a button to change their job - click that button and then click on the warehouse building you want them to work at. This will transfer them to the warehouse AND they keep possession of the stall. Hopefully this helps!

    So the market covers all homes in the region regardless of distance. They fulfill the closest houses first and work their way out to the furthest. As long as you have enough for in the stalls to cover 100% then you'll be and to get 100%. Make sure you have enough stalls to have capacity for 100% and make sure your stalls are close enough to the storehouse and granary so they can refill quickly. If they are too far, they won't resupply fast enough to reach 100%

    @@nougan_gamer it depends on how many goods you have. An easy example is firewood. If you have 10 burgage plots, then your stalls will have a max of 10 firewood between all the stalls. If you have 2 firewood stall, then you're wasting a worker because you only need 1. The stall can hold 50 so you would still have room for 40 more (10/50). Food is more complicated - if you have 3 food types then that one stall will have 30/50 at Max capacity. Now imagine you double your plots to 20, then you'll need 60 total space but only have room for 50. That's time to expand the market place to add more stalls. 2 food stalls have a combined 100 inventory capacity so you'll be good for a while longer. Just figure out your plot count and how many different types of goods you have and that will tell you stalls. General rule of thumb you can just is 3 stalls for the first 15 plots and then 3 more for every 20-25 plots you add
